KAWARTHA LAKES-Kawartha Lakes Police Service is looking to identify a suspect after a window was smashed at a business in Lindsay.
Police say on Wednesday April 14, 2021 the City of Kawartha Lakes Police received a report of mischief to a William Street South business in Lindsay. At 3:21am, the suspect walked through the parking lot and approached the entrance of the business. Using a skateboard, the suspect proceeded to break the glass of the entrance door before leaving the area on foot.
The suspect is described as, approximately 5’11’’ tall, dark long hair, thin build, wearing a grey Helly Hansen jacket, green pants, dark shoes and carrying a blue back pack.
